ISTANBUL - Labor, Peace and Democracy Forces called for the "No way to trustees" rally and said: "The day is from Hakkari to Istanbul; It is the day to expand the united struggle of the oppressed and exploited."

Istanbul Labor, Peace and Democracy Forces held a press conference against the appointment of a trustee to the Colemêrg (Hakkari-Kurdistan) Municipality for the rally they will hold in Kartal Square on June 29 with the motto "We Will Not Allow a Trustee for Our Labor and Freedom". A banner saying "We will not allow trustees to pass for our labor and freedom" was hung at the meeting held in a hotel in Beyoğlu district. Details about the rally were announced at the meeting attended by representatives of unions, political parties, institutions and organizations.
 
Ayşegül Devecioğlu, member of the Union for Democracy (DİB) Coordination Board, who read the press text, stated that one of the main reasons for political instability, poverty, inequality and violation of rights and freedoms in Turkey is dependence on the capitalist-imperialist system and capital.
